Named in honor of Yoko Nomura (1950– ), wife of the first discoverer and an independent discoverer of comet C/1975 N1. “Yoko” means “a child of the sun”. (M 35484) _ _.


Discovered on 11-11-1990 in Minami-Oda by Nomura, T., Kawanishi, K.
